Vacuum Instruments Corporation (VIC Leak Detection), a leader in helium leak detection instrumentation and custom automated test systems, is seeking a motivated and detail oriented

Controls Engineering Intern to support our engineering and automation team.

This internship provides hands-on experience in industrial automation, with exposure to real-world applications involving PLC programming, HMI development, and system integration across a variety of platforms and industries.

Key Responsibilities

- Assist in the development and modification of PLC programs, primarily using ladder logic

- Support HMI (Human Machine Interface) design and programming for custom leak

detection and test systems

- Work with multiple PLC/HMI platforms, including Allen-Bradley, Siemens, Omron,

Automation Direct, and other industry-standard controls platforms

- Participate in system testing, debugging, and validation activities

- Assist with electrical and controls documentation, including I/O lists and wiring diagrams

- Support commissioning activities both in-house and, when applicable, at customer sites

- Collaborate with mechanical, electrical, and applications engineers to implement integrated system solutions

- Troubleshoot control systems and assist in resolving technical issues on the production floor
